Cvetan Čurlinov
Cvetan Čurlinov (Macedonian: Цветан Чурлинов; born 24 July 1986) is a Macedonian footballer who plays as a forward for FC Aegeri. Born in Gevgelija, he has played for many clubs in North Macedonia and abroad, including Kalamata in Greece, Žalgiris Vilnius in Lithuania and FK Baku in Azerbaijan. He also spent time with Horizont Turnovo and Metalurg Skopje in the Macedonian First League, as well as other teams in Macedonia and Switzerland. Čurlinov represented the Macedonia U21 national team, earning four caps between 2006 and 2007. Notable moments include his Greek league debut for Kalamata as a second-half substitute against Kallithea on 24 September 2006, and signing a two-year contract with Metalurg Skopje in August 2011.
